| 20110048316 | High-Temperature Process Improvements Using Helium Under Regulated Pressure - A method for minimizing unwanted ancillary reactions in a vacuum furnace used to process a material, such as growing a crystal. The process is conducted in a furnace chamber environment in which helium is admitted to the furnace chamber at a flow rate to flush out impurities and at a predetermined pressure to achieve thermal stability in a heat zone, to minimize heat flow variations and to minimize temperature gradients in the heat zone. During cooldown helium pressure is used to reduce thermal gradients in order to increase cooldown rates. | 03-03-2011 |

| 20090000334 | Glass bending process - A glass bending line for quickly shaping a complex bent glass sheet is provided that includes moving a ring-type female mold, which has a heated glass sheet placed on it, and a full face heated male mold, toward one another. Upon making shaping contact between the glass sheet and the male mold, a vacuum is applied through holes extending through the male mold, for a time sufficient to form the glass sheet to a desired shape. When the glass sheet has been shaped, the vacuum is terminated and pressurized air is connected to the holes to release the bent glass sheet from the male mold. The bent glass sheet is then quickly transported to a quenching station or an annealing station on a continuous conveying device. Hence, the complex bent glass sheet is achieved without the use of a shuttle ring. | 01-01-2009 |

| 20100079116 | Battery charging method - A charging and equalizing method for a battery having a control computer in a charging system in communication with a plurality of module processors. Charging and equalization pauses periodically for voltage measurement by the module processors. The control computer determines when to equalize battery cells in the modules based on their open circuit voltages transmitted by the module processors. A selected group of cells in each module can be equalized. Equalization is carried out in the modules until all of the module processors indicate that equalization has been completed. Charging can then resume until charging is complete or cells reach a maximum voltage given by the control computer. In an alternative embodiment, a selected group of cells may be partially bypassed while charging to reduce the charge rate of the cell. | 04-01-2010 |

| 20100108776 | ADJUSTABLE COLD SPRAY NOZZLE - A cold spray nozzle assembly includes a venturi having converging and diverging portions interconnected at a throat. An air supply conduit is in communication with the venturi for supplying a carrier gas to the converging portion. A powder feed tube is in communication with the venturi for supplying a powder material. An adjustment member is arranged within the venturi and is axially moveable relative thereto between multiple positions. The multiple positions respectively provide multiple different areas or throat clearances including a desired area between the adjustment member and the venturi or throat clearance. As a result, the adjustment member can be axially positioned to achieve desired gas pressures, deposition rates, and accommodate machining tolerances and component wear based upon the selected area. A retention member maintains the adjustment member in the desired position during operation of the cold spray nozzle assembly. | 05-06-2010 |
